... well, perhaps the OP booked and paid for an XL-Seat and is now stuck somewhere else (AB has a very narrow pitch, apart from XL-Seats). So I can understand the OP's frustration.

Apart from that: There is really a bug in AB's OLCI system, if you have two or more legs in your itinerary and the first one is open while the latter ones are between 48 and 30 hours out. Then the OLCI system - from my experience - always denies check-in, also for the first leg, and - even more frustrating - eliminates all seat reserveration of the entire itinerary ... I stopped using OLCI, except for very simple itineraries with just one one way flight or a return flight further than 48 hours out.

Also the on-line system doesn't automatically recognise OW status for free seat selection. The usual work around of using Finnair doesn't work either.
So you have to call up.

The first time I called they put me in the wrong seats, apparently there was a misunderstanding between us of 'B' and 'D'. (I wanted B&C, I got given D&C).
I thought I would just wait until T-30 to see if I could change it then (as I thought it unlikely anyone would take the 'B' seat I wanted. When I went to OLCI it wouldn't let me select B, however the whole row was full (the XL row), which I suspected was not actually the case, merely that the system was blanking it out.
So I called up and asked them to move the seats together, they moved me to A&B (and I can see this on finnair.com), however when I log back in to OLCI it thinks I am still in C&D!
I'm just going to hope I can sort it at the airport. Buggy system indeed!

With regards to the topic, my experience has been much more positive:

- The AB bookings that I have linked to my BA# are shown when logging into the EC homepage
- Their system automatically preassigns me a seat (aisle, typically around row 6) which also shows on the BA page
- I can check in through AB without any issues (have not been on a connecting flight yet)
- For longer flights the hotline was happy to change my seat reservations to the exit row free of charge. Given that they are making passengers pay for these seats, in one out of two flights I had the entire exit row for myself

Only annoying thing so far is that BA Gold does not prompt the gates to their priority waiting area to open.
